Jason Atwood is a seasoned professional in project management and advisory services, currently serving as Vice President and Shareholder at Northstar Project & Real Estate Services since April 2013. Jason has held various roles within the company, including Associate Vice President, Senior Project Manager, and Project Manager. Prior experience includes positions as Field Services Manager and Project Manager at Triumvirate Environmental, as well as Assistant Project Manager at Northstar Project and Real Estate Services, and Project Manager at TMC Services, Inc. Jason hol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Economics from the University of Massachusetts Amherst, obtained between 2001 and 2005.

Northstar Project & Real Estate Services is a privately held firm focusing solely on real estate development and project management. Our team of professionals serves institutional, higher education, life science, medical, commercial, residential, and research and development clients in the greater Boston area. Northstar’s projects range from $25K to $2.0B and cover the spectrum from tenant improvement to discretionary permitting and ground-up construction. We are a nimble firm with a tight-knit, family-orientated culture with dedicated partners and employees who all bring something unique to the table. Our services include the following: Project Management: Complete range of interior fit-up and building renovation projects. Northstar can assist in the entire process, from space requirements to design and construction. Development Management: Experienced in all aspects of build-to-suit and ground-up development projects. Northstar manages the process from hiring designers and contractors to construction and move-in. Advisory Services: Northstar will assist with your project and real estate needs; including master planning, pre-acquisition due diligence, building repositioning, land use planning, and long-term capital planning for institutions.
